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- OmarHack

#541
Cita de: engelx en 29 Junio 2013, 15:45 PM
(en ciudad no se necesita que un carro supere 140km/h)
Ya, pero los coches no se hacen solo para ciudad. 140 en algunas carreteras es como 20 en ciudad. No me gastaría 20.000 euros en un clase E que pasara de 200 km/h ni harto de vino xD
#542
Yo lo haría de otra manera, se que no quieres códigos pero te lo pondré para que lo entiendas, es más fácil de explicar.

Código (cpp) [Seleccionar]
#include <iostream>
using namespace std;
int a;
int b;
signed short  numeroDadoPorElUsuario;
signed short numeroDosDadoPorElUsuario;
signed short resultado;
unsigned long resultadoReal;

int main()
{
cout << "pon tu numero: ";
cin >> a;
numeroDadoPorElUsuario = a;


cout << endl << "pon el segundo numero: ";
cin >> b;

numeroDosDadoPorElUsuario = b;



resultado = numeroDadoPorElUsuario * numeroDosDadoPorElUsuario;
resultadoReal = numeroDadoPorElUsuario * numeroDosDadoPorElUsuario;

cout << "El resultado del programa es: " << resultado << endl;
cout << "El resultado de la operacion es: " << resultadoReal << endl;

if (resultado != resultadoReal)
{
cout <<"La operación introducida ha superado el rango de signed short";
              }

getchar();
getchar();

return 0;
}


Te lo he puesto en C++ que me es mucho más fácil, compílalo y multiplica 9999 por 9, podrás comprobar que te da el valor que coge en un signed short, pero que da la vuelta al pasarse de rango. También te da el valor de un long que en ese caso sería el valor real, dependiendo del caso habría que modificar, o buscar alguna alternativa. Después con un if compruebas si el resultado es el mismo y si no lo es, sabes que el valor del signed short se a pasado. Te comento el código a continuación.

Incluimos la librería de entrada y salida.
Declaramos que usaremos el cin y el cout que se encuentra en el namespace std. Es solo para que el compilador encuentre cin y cout, que viene siendo scanf y printf simplificados, lo mismo.

Lo que hace básicamente el programa es guardar el resultado en un short y el resultado en un long cada uno en una variable distinta, entonces el número 89991 se pasa del rango de un short pero cabe en un long.

Sencillo, me entendiste no? Un saludo!
#543
Cita de: ivancea96 en 27 Junio 2013, 14:29 PM
Jeje muy bueno xD Un chiste es mejor si solo lo entendemos nosotros :PPP


PD:Me pones nervioso crazykenny :S Entiendo que seas educado, pero que esas frases se hayan convertido en el TOP copy-paste de tu PC... xD
Hace bien, ojalá muchos tuvieran su consideración.
Un saludo!
#544
GNU/Linux / Re: [Ubuntu] Soy Novato
28 Junio 2013, 13:46 PM
Te hice una pregunta que no contestaste, así no vas a aprender, supongo que no te interesa.
#545
Guay, si pudierais responder en que casos es mejor uno u otro en relación calidad/precio, así podría tener como un manual de referencia por si alguien me pregunta, ya que me intento sacar unas pelas con esto y si me hace falta en un futuro me gustaría realizar lo mejor posible este tipo de trabajos. Saludos y gracias por responder! :)
#546
Si los tuviera yo le encontraría uso a todos. xD
Pues según el servidor que hagas, pude ser un servidor de correo, un servidor web etc. Puedes comprar  una pieza que hay para conectar muchos discos duros, conectas todos los de los portátiles al servidor, haces un servidor web y puedes llenarlo de música, películas, etc y verlo desde la red local o subirlo a internet para usarlo de hosting.
#547
Es ese. ¿10 metros de RJ11 pueden alterar mucho la velocidad?
#548
Foro Libre / Re: El Hacker!!!...
27 Junio 2013, 17:32 PM
Son los típicos tópicos jaja
#549
GNU/Linux / Re: [Ubuntu] Soy Novato
27 Junio 2013, 17:31 PM
Cita de: juandiegov en 27 Junio 2013, 14:47 PM
nunca e presumido de algo si presumiera no vendria a pregungar algo aca no crees si uno pregunta es  por que no save
Pues perdona entonces, sabes hacer defaces? Un saludo :)
#550
Pues apunta a la gráfica como bien dices tú :S Puedes usarlo de servidor para aprovecharlo, le metes ubuntu server que viene sin entorno gráfico. Un saludo.